I'm Margaret and I'm the new SP8 district coordinator for Somerset.

I was born on Isle of Arran, Scotland and went to Gray’s School of Art in Aberdeen where I gained a B.A (Hons) in Fine Art.

As a fine artist I have been involved in exhibitions all over the UK and also abroad and was a participating artist in the Built Environment Exhibition at Bridgwater Arts Centre (2006); Somerset Landscape Artists Exhibition, Trowbridge Gallery, Castle Cary (2008) and North Somerset Art Week (2009).

I have had solo exhibitions at Taunton Library and Sea Breeze Gallery, Burnham-on-Sea (summer 2008). Recently as a participating artist in River Brue Arts Festival (August 2008), I produced 3D work,and assisted in the planning and ran family workshops in the Apex park as part of that festival.

My work has also been sold to Ireland, Scotland and USA.

I have also been involved in primary education for a number of years as a teaching assistant and am now working as a Forest School Leader (BTEC 3 (Advanced) Forest School Leaders Qualification) with Reception through to Year 2 pupils. I am responsible for planning and delivering sessions. I also run an Art Club for Year 2 children at lunchtime and have been involved in another school as a visiting artist.

I am on SPAEDA’s Artists Portfolio Project and recently took part in ‘Safe Routes to School Project’ as part of their Voluntary EMERGE Placement Scheme, working with Year 6 children.

I decided to get involved with SP8 of the Art because I would love to have the opportunity to help provide and promote well planned and unique artistic activities for all children to take part in.
